1.Comparison of bioelectrical impedance analysis and dual energy X ray absorptiometry in measuring body composition among Tibetan children and adolescents
Chinese Journal of School Health 2026;47(4):569-573
Objective:
To compare the consistency between bioelectrical impedance analysis (BIA) and dual energy X ray absorptiometry (DXA) in measuring body composition among Tibetan children and adolescents and to explore the applicability of BIA in plateau region, so as to provide scientific and convenient body composition measurement support among children and adolescents.
Methods:
From May to June, 2022, a total of 344 Tibetan children and adolescents aged 6-17 years were selected from Golmud Municipal National Middle School and Changjiangyuan Nationality Primary School in Qinghai Province by cluster sampling method, and their fat mass, fat mass percentage and lean mass were measured by DXA and BIA. The consistency and correlation between the two methods were assessed by using the Wilcoxon rank-sum test, Spearman correlation analysis, intraclass correlation coefficient (ICC), and Bland-Altman analysis.
Results:
DXA measured fat mass and fat mass percentage were significantly higher than those obtained by BIA (6-12 years old: Z =9.91, 11.28; 13-17 years old: Z =9.02, 10.21), while lean mass and lean mass percentage were significantly lower than BIA results (6-12 years old: Z =-11.60, -11.30; 13-17 years old: Z =-10.77, -10.36) (all P < 0.05 ). The two methods showed strong correlations in fat mass and lean mass (all r >0.80, all ICC >0.90), but exhibited poor agreement in fat mass percentage and lean mass percentage (6-12 years old: Lin s CCC =0.64, 0.41; 13-17 years old: Lin s CCC = 0.79 , 0.35). Bland-Altman analysis showed that the difference between the two methods was negatively correlated with the average value in FM%(6-12 years old: r =-0.75, 13-17 years old: r =-0.79, both P <0.01).
Conclusion
BIA and DXA show high consistency in measuring body fat mass and lean body mass in Tibetan children and adolescents, although some bias is still present in certain individuals.
2.The effect of IL-8 secreted by tumor-associated macrophages on colorectal cancer metastasis
Ya SU ; Luyun YUAN ; Qiang ZHANG ; Haijing WANG
Acta Universitatis Medicinalis Anhui 2026;61(6):978-985
ObjectiveTo investigate the role of interleukin (IL)-8 secreted by tumor-associated macrophages (TAMs) in colorectal cancer (CRC) metastasis and its potential therapeutic value. MethodsThe TAMs model was constructed by phorbol ester (PMA) combined with IL-4/IL-13, and the model phenotype was verified by flow cytometry, RT-qPCR and ELISA. Human CRC HCT116 cells were treated with conditioned medium (CM) from M0 macrophages and TAMs, and the metastatic capacity of HCT116 cells was evaluated by wound-healing assay and Transwell assay. The expression levels of IL-8 in M0 macrophages and TAMs were detected by Western blot, RT-qPCR and ELISA. The expression level of epithelial-mesenchymal transition (EMT) markers (E-cadherin, N-cadherin) in HCT116 cells treated with CM-M0 and CM-TAMs were detected by Western blot and RT-qPCR. HCT116 cells were stimulated with CM-TAMs supplemented with IL-8 receptor inhibitor Reparixin. The HCT116 cells metastasis ability was evaluated by wound-healing assay and Transwell assay, and the expression levels of E-cadherin and N-cadherin were detected by Western blot and RT-qPCR. Finally, a splenic injection liver metastasis model was established using murine CRC cells CT26-LUC, and the effect of Reparixin on this animal model was observed by in vivo imaging. ResultsFlow cytometry showed that the proportion of M2 macrophages (CD11b+CD206+ cells) was elevated in the TAMs model. RT-qPCR and ELISA assays revealed that the levels of M2 macrophage markers IL-10 and TGF-βsignificantly increased. Wound-healing assay and Transwell assay demonstrated that CM-TAMs significantly enhanced the migration and invasion ability of HCT116 cells. Western blot, RT-qPCR and ELISA assays showed that TAMs highly expressed IL-8 and simultaneously induced downregulation of E-cadherin and upregulation of N-cadherin in HCT116 cells. Reparixin not only reversed the pro-metastatic effects of CM-TAMs, but also upregulated the expression level of E-cadherin and downregulated that of N-cadherin in HCT116 cells. Furthermore, it reduced the bioluminescence signal intensity of liver metastatic lesions in the splenic injection liver metastasis model. ConclusionThe TAMs promote CRC metastasis by secreting IL-8 to induce EMT. Inhibiting IL-8 secretion in TAMs or blocking the binding of IL-8 to its receptor may provide a new strategy for CRC treatment.
3.Longitudinal study on core symptoms and nursing strategies for patients with colorectal cancer undergoing postoperative chemotherapy
Cunfeng ZHENG ; Zheng WANG ; Haijing LIU ; Jie GAO ; Ya QIN ; Qing ZHANG
Chinese Journal of Nursing 2025;60(11):1309-1315
Objective To explore the changes in symptom clusters and core symptoms at different stages in col-orectal cancer patients undergoing postoperative chemotherapy,and to provide a reference for developing precise symptom management strategies in clinical practice.Methods 300 colorectal cancer patients who underwent post-operative chemotherapy at 2 tertiary hospitals in Tianjin from August 2023 to May 2024 were conveniently selected as the study subjects.General information questionnaires and the Chinese version of the MD Anderson Symptom In-ventory for Colorectal Cancer were used to survey patients during the first chemotherapy cycle(T1)and the third chemotherapy cycle(T2).Exploratory factor analysis was used to extract symptom clusters;R language was used to construct symptom networks.Results 300 questionnaires were distributed and collected at T1,and 264 question-naires were distributed and collected at T2,with a recovery rate of 88.00%.Colorectal cancer patients undergoing postoperative chemotherapy had 5 symptom clusters at T1,and 4 symptom clusters at T2.In the symptom network,distress was the symptom with the highest strength(rs=1.188),closeness centrality(rc=0.004),and betweenness centrality(rb=36)at T1.Distress was the symptom with the highest strength(rs=1.397),while decreased appetite had the highest closeness centrality(rc=0.004)and betweenness centrality(rb=39)at T2.Conclusion The symptom clusters in colorectal cancer patients undergoing postoperative chemotherapy remain stable over time.Distress is a stable core symptom during chemotherapy,while decreased appetite is a bridging symptom in the mid-chemotherapy phase.Healthcare providers should prioritize interventions for decreased appetite while addressing emotional symptoms to improve the efficiency of symptom management.
4.Research progress on the reproductive toxicity of isotretinoin and clinical management strategies
Junhong NING ; Haijing CAO ; Ting ZHANG
Chinese Journal of Reproduction and Contraception 2025;45(10):1077-1080
Isotretinoin is a highly effective and commonly used drug in the clinical treatment of severe acne, but its significant reproductive toxicity limits its clinical application. Current literature studies have shown that isotretinoin exerts widespread effects on the reproductive system through multiple pathways, including interference with the retinoic acid signaling pathway, induction of oxidative stress, and apoptosis. Therefore, in-depth dissection of its reproductive toxicity mechanisms, optimization of clinical risk management strategies, and development of safer alternative drugs are of great clinical and practical significance. Future research may focus on deepening mechanisms under the framework of precision medicine, individualized prevention and control strategies, and drug innovation to balance drug efficacy and safety.This article systematically reviews the toxic effects of isotretinoin on the reproductive system, including teratogenicity, its impact on female and male reproductive function , and explores in depth its molecular mechanisms, and clinical risk management strategies.

7.PageRank Algorithm and Factor Analysis Assists the Identification of Treatment Patterns of Chinese Herbal Medicine for Immunoglobulin A Nephropathy
Jiayan LU ; La ZHANG ; Xiaoxuan HU ; Xitao LING ; Haotian YU ; Ziyue LIANG ; Zuochen LU ; Haijing HOU ; Fuhua LU ; Nizhi YANG
World Science and Technology-Modernization of Traditional Chinese Medicine 2024;26(3):581-590
Objective The objective of this study was to provide methodological references for the inheritance of the experience of well-known Chinese medicine doctors in the treatment of kidney disease.Methods The study collected medical case data for IgA nephropathy,diagnosed and treated by Professor Yang Nizhi's outpatient department at Guangdong Provincial Hospital of Traditional Chinese Medicine from 2010 to 2020.The data was standardized and divided into three groups:urine and blood,urine turbidity,and renal failure groups.The study utilized the FangNet platform to apply the PageRank algorithm and calculate the THScore of different subgroups of core herbs for IgA nephropathy.The distribution pattern of syndrome differentiation and corresponding herb use regulations were visualized through Python(SciPy package,Clusterheatmap package),and the study explored and verified the drug prescription through exploratory and confirmatory factor analysis based on Pearson correlation coefficient.The weighted least squares estimation mean and variance adjusted(WLSMV)and the oblique rotated GEOMIN method were used with the Mplus software.Results The study included a total of 548 treatments for 145 patients with IgA nephropathy,with heamturia group(54 cases),urine turbidity group(51 cases),and renal failure group(40 cases).Results showed 9 basic syndromes such as Qi deficiency syndrome(91.79%),blood stasis syndrome(77.01%),damp-heat syndrome(66.06%),and Yin deficiency syndrome(38.69%).There are 24 core drugs in total,23 in the urine and blood group,21 in the urine turbidity group,and 16 in the renal failure group.These drugs mainly include qi-tonifying and yang-invigorating drugs,nourishing yin and blood drugs,promoting blood circulation and removing blood stasis drugs,and clearing heat and cooling blood drugs.The regulations for the differentiation and medication of IgA nephropathy(Z-Score>0.5 and P<0.05)were as follows:Huangqi,Shan Zhu Yu,and Tusizi were commonly used in Qi deficiency syndrome;Danshen,Ze Lan,and Shan Zhu Yu were commonly used in blood stasis syndrome;Pu Gong Ying,Shi Wei,Tao Ren,and Tu Fu Ling were commonly used in damp-heat syndrome;and Mo Han Lian,Tai Zi Shen,and Nv Zhen Zi were commonly used in Yin deficiency syndrome.Through exploratory and confirmatory factor analysis,the core drug combination factors for the treatment of IgA nephropathy by Professor Yang Nizhi were obtained as follows:F1(Tusizi,Shan Zhu Yu,Huangqi);F2(White Mao Gen,Xiao Ji,Qian Cao);F3(Nv Zhen Zi,Mo Han Lian,Tai Zi Shen);and F4(Ze Lan,Tao Ren).Conclusion This study analyzed the diagnosis and treatment experience of Professor Yang Nizhi in the treatment of IgA nephropathy by grouping,defining the core syndrome of"Qi deficiency and blood stasis,damp-heat and Yin deficiency",and the core treatment methods of"tonifying Qi,promoting blood circulation,clearing heat,and nourishing Yin"using the PageRank algorithm and Mplus factor analysis.The study provided methodological references for the inheritance of the experience of famous Chinese medicine doctors and promoted the development and utilization of traditional Chinese medicine.
8.Analysis of influencing factors on the inclusion of Chinese patent medicines in the national reimbursement drug list
Shihuan CAO ; Wanxian LIANG ; Lining ZHANG ; Haijing GUAN ; Xuejing JIN
China Pharmacy 2024;35(22):2709-2715
OBJECTIVE To analyze the factors affecting the inclusion of Chinese patent medicines in China’s National reimbursement drug list (NRDL), and assist these medicines in fully reflecting their actual value in the reimbursement admission process. METHODS From the official website of the China’s National Healthcare Security Administration, the application materials of Chinese patent medicines outside the list that passed the formal review from 2021 to 2023 were obtained, including basic information on the medicines, safety, efficacy, innovation and heritage information, and supplemented with references from the pharmacopeia and the Yaozhi Database. Economic information and enterprise information were obtained through websites such as the Yaozhi Database. Univariate analysis, multivariate Logistic regression analysis and stepwise regression analysis were conducted on the initial application information and admission outcomes of the medicines. Sensitivity analysis was also performed on medicines that applied multiple times in different years as independent samples. RESULTS & CONCLUSIONS There were 27 Chinese patent medicines that passed the formal review from 2021 to 2023, involving 37 applications. The univariate analysis results showed that medicines with descriptions of traditional Chinese medicine (TCM) syndrome types, clear adjustment information for medication plans for specific population groups, short time to market in the indications of the package insert, registered as Class 1 to 6 following or class Ⅰ innovative TCM/class Ⅲ ancient classic prescription compound TCM registered, and those produced by enterprises listed in the “Top 100 Chinese Pharmaceutical Industry Enterprises” list for the current year were more likely to be included in the NRDL (P<0.05). The results of the multivariate Logistic regression analysis were not statistically significant, but the stepwise regression results indicated good consistency with the univariate analysis. The results of the sensitivity analysis were consistent with the trend of basic analysis. It is recommended that Chinese patent medicine enterprises further clarify the description of product instructions, expand innovation capabilities, inherit and develop ancient classic prescriptions, and promptly complete clinical trial evidence.

10.Correlation of contrast-enhanced ultrasound parameters of adenomyoma before and after MR-guided focused ultrasound surgery with therapeutic efficacy
Peidi ZHANG ; Xiao YANG ; Jianmin ZHENG ; Haijing LIU ; Lina PANG ; Lei DING ; Wen LUO
Chinese Journal of Interventional Imaging and Therapy 2024;21(5):257-261
Objective To explore the correlation of contrast-enhanced ultrasound(CEUS)parameters of adenomyoma before and after MR-guided focused ultrasound surgery(MRgFUS)with the therapeutic efficacy.Methods Uterine ultrasound and CEUS data of 26 patients with adenomyoma before and 24 h,1 and 6 months after MRgFUS,as well as MRI before and immediately after MRgFUS were retrospectively analyzed.The lesion volume shown on CEUS and MRI before MRgFUS,the non perfusion volume(NPV)of adenomyoma on MRI immediately after and CEUS 24 h after MRgFUS were compared.The ablation rate of lesions was calculated based on CEUS 24 h after MRgFUS.The focal blood flow score before,24 h after MRgFUS and the sum of the two,also the numerical rating scale(NRS)score before and 1,6 months after MRgFUS and the change rate were analyzed.The correlations of CEUS parameters with the efficacy of MRgFUS for treating adenomyoma were observed.Results No significant difference of lesion volume nor NPV on CEUS or MRI was found(both P>0.05).The ablation rate of lesions 24 h after treatment was(58.11±24.92)%.The focal blood flow score before,24 h after MRgFUS and the sum of the two was 2.00(2.00,2.00),1.00(1.00,1.00)and 3.50(3.00,3.50),respectively,with significant difference between before and 24 h after MRgFUS(Z=-4.463,P<0.001).NRS score was 5.00(4.00,6.00),3.00(2.00,4.00)and 2.00(1.00,3.00)before treatment,1 and 6 months after treatment,respectively,with significant differences at different time points(all P<0.01).The change rate of NRS score 1 and 6 months after treatment was 35.42%(23.75%,50.00%)and 60.00%(50.00%,77.08%),respectively.The lesion blood flow score before and 24 h after MRgFUS and the sum of the two were all negatively correlated with ablation rate(rs=-0.552,-0.820,-0.745),while positively correlated with NRS scores 6 months after treatment(rs=0.513,0.552,0.496)but negatively correlated with the change rate of NRS scores 6 months after treatment(rs=-0.525,-0.479,-0.531).The ablation rate 24 h after treatment was negatively correlated with NRS scores(rs=-0.462)while positively correlated with the change rate of NRS scores 6 months after treatment(rs=0.500).Conclusion CEUS parameters before and after treatment were correlated with the therapeutic efficacy of MRgFUS for treating adenomyoma.
